oracle资源管理指南(oracle rm)

Oracle是一款广泛使用的关系型数据库管理系统,它为企业提供了完整的数据管理解决方案。而在使用Oracle的过程中,资源管理是其中一个非常重要的方面,资源管理正确配置可以提高系统的性能,同时也可以避免资源浪费。本文将为大家介绍一些关于Oracle资源管理的指南。

1. Oracle资源管理的概念

Oracle资源管理指的是通过控制用户会话和进程,比如限制用户的资源使用,来优化数据库系统的性能和可靠性的过程。 在Oracle中,可以通过实现资源管理来保护其他用户或者进程免受某个用户或进程的大量资源消耗的影响。

2. Oracle资源管理的实现

Oracle可以通过三种方法实现资源管理:基于资源消耗的限制、执行计划和指定管理策略。

基于资源消耗的限制是一种简单的方法,它可以为每个会话分配一些特定的资源限制。在设定这些资源的同时,可以指定一个时间窗口,以便在此时间窗口内控制资源的使用情况。

执行计划是另一种方法,通过这些计划来设置何时可以限制用户的资源使用情况,并指定哪些资源是发生问题的关键因素。

第三种方法是指定管理策略来控制和监视资源的使用情况。管理策略可以包括使用Oracle的特定工具和监视程序来实现。

3. Oracle资源管理的策略

Oracle资源管理策略包括基于用户和基于组的资源限制、母集群实例和创建实例模板。对于资源使用量特别大的会话,Oracle资源管理提供了一种会话状态检查的机制,可以更好的保护系统。在资源管理上,最重要的是要确保这些策略是准确地配置了,避免一些无效的限制出现,从而造成资源的浪费。

4. Oracle资源管理的工具

Oracle提供了一些非常好用的资源管理工具,这些工具可以帮助管理员检查系统是否已经为所有的会话进行了配置,并且避免系统的性能问题。这些工具可以监控各种资源使用情况,包括CPU和内存使用、I/O使用和网络流量情况。

5. 如何配置Oracle资源管理

在配置Oracle资源管理的时候,我们需要注意以下几点:

1)明确哪些资源需要被进行管理和限制,比如CPU时间、内存使用和磁盘I/O等。

2)对于每个资源建立一个合理的资源限制规则。

3)对于会话,应为其设定尽可能详细的限制参数。

4)有些系统上的操作可能需要临时提供更多的资源。在应用程序中,应该设置应用程序的一个系统变量,来对临时操作提供更多的系统资源。

6. 总结

在使用Oracle的过程中,资源管理是非常重要的一个方面。Oracle提供了一系列的资源管理策略和工具,可以帮助管理员来管理和监控系统的资源使用情况。配置这些策略的时候,需要注意明确需要进行管理和限制的资源类型,并且为每个资源建立一个合理的资源限制规则。只有正确的配置和使用Oracle的资源管理工具,才能实现系统性能的优化和资源的最优利用。


数据运维技术 » oracle资源管理指南(oracle rm)